Airspeed Clone Air Filter Adapter & Bracket

  • Specifications:

    • After extensive testing, 8 prototypes, over 200 dyno pulls on 3 different motors, up against every adapter that we could find, the AIRSPEED adapter from Performance Manufacturing has proven without a doubt, positive gains and a broader power curve on box stock class clone engines, specifically with top end "drop off" common with other adapters.

      Product Specifications:

      • Airspeed Clone air filter adapter- black

    BMI Part Number: PM-007100

New MoT failure figures reveal surprises

Mon, 30 Sep 2013

BETWEEN January and August 2013 253,000 vehicles failed their first MoT, according to new data. 70 million records from the Vehicle Operation and Services Agency (VOSA) were examined to reveal the patterns of failure for cars receiving their first MoT, required three years from the date of first registration. However, while the best performers have pre-existing reputations for reliability, the bottom of the table reveals some surprises.

Maserati GranTurismo Sport (2012) first official pictures

Mon, 20 Feb 2012

This is the new Maserati GranTurismo Sport, a more powerful and more aggressively styled version of the Trident’s big GT that will be unveiled at the Geneva motor show in March 2012. How is the Maserati GranTurismo Sport different from all Maserati’s other GranTurismo models? The GranTurismo Sport effectively replaces the GranTurismo S, and sits one rung below the hardcore GranTurismo MC Stradale.
